The HDJD-J822 is a CMOS mixedsignal IC designed to be the optical feedback controller of an LED-based lighting system. A typical system consists of an array of red, green and blue LEDs, LED drivers, a tri-color photosensor that samples the light output, and the HDJD-J822.The IC interfaces directly to the photosensor, processes the color information and adjusts the light output from the LEDs until the desired color is achieved. To achieve this, the IC integrates a high-accuracy 10-bit analog-to-digital converter front-end, a color data processing logic core, and a high-resolution 12-bit PWM output generator.
By employing a feedback system and the HDJD-J822, the light output produced by the LED array maintains its color over time and temperature. In addition, the desired color can be specified using a standard CIE color space.
In addition, by incorporating a standard I2C serial interface, specifying the color of the LED array's light output is as simple as picking the color coordinates from the CIE color space and writing several bytes of data to the device.
The output PWM signals are connected directly to the LED drivers as enable signals. The PWM signals control the on-time duration of the red, green and blue LEDs. That duration is continually adjusted in real-time to match the light output from the LED array to the specified,desired color.
